#4a5d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a5d4c is composed of 29% red, 36.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 126.3 degrees, a saturation of 11.4% and a lightness of 32.7%. #4a5d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#94ba98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#4a5d4c color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#4a5d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a5d4c has RGB values of R:74, G:93,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 4873548.
